Understanding Vacuum Brazing vs. Traditional Bonding Techniques

Traditional bonding methods for diamond grinding wheels typically involve resin or electroplated bonds, which, while cost-effective, suffer from relatively short lifespans and inconsistent grit retention. Vacuum brazing fundamentally alters the manufacturing approach by using a high-temperature vacuum environment to fuse diamond particles directly onto the metal substrate with a robust metallic bond.

This process results in a grinding wheel with:

  • Up to 30%-50% longer operational lifetime compared to conventional resin-bonded wheels.
  • Exceptional grip on diamond abrasives, drastically reducing grit loss during intensive operations.
  • Consistent cutting surface quality, contributing to superior surface finish on high hardness castings.

Performance Excellence in Cast Iron and Ductile Iron Deburring

High hardness castings like gray cast iron (~200–300 HB hardness) and ductile iron (~210–320 HB) present unique machining challenges, including rapid tool wear and difficulties in removing stubborn burrs without surface damage.

The vacuum brazed diamond grinding wheel excels in:

  • Sharpness retention: The metallic bond ensures diamonds remain firmly anchored, maintaining sharp cutting edges that deliver consistent burr removal.
  • Durability: Field tests from leading foundries show a lifespan extension allowing 1,500+ hours of continuous use without significant performance drop, equaling 2-3x that of resin-bond wheels.
  • Optimized surface finish: Enables a smooth deburring and surface grinding process, reducing secondary finishing needs by 20%, saving labor and cost.

Maintaining Peak Grinding Performance: Practical Tips

Consistent maintenance is vital to extract maximum value and lifecycle from vacuum brazed diamond grinding wheels. Recommended best practices include:

  • Regular cleaning: Remove residual metal particles post-use with non-acidic solvents to prevent grit clogging.
  • Scheduled dressing: Using diamond dressing tools to restore wheel sharpness and roundness approximately every 200 operating hours.
  • Correct operating parameters: Maintain cutting speeds between 20-30 m/s and consistent feed rates to avoid thermal damage.

Tailored Solutions: Choosing the Right Size and Specification

Henan Youde offers a comprehensive range of vacuum brazed diamond grinding wheels, varying in diameters from 150 mm to 600 mm and thicknesses from 10 mm to 30 mm. Selecting the correct dimension based on specific casting size and machining applications is crucial to maximize throughput and control costs.

For instance:

  • Small to medium castings: 150-250 mm wheels improve maneuverability and precision.
  • Large castings or heavy-duty tasks: 350-600 mm wheels offer higher material removal rates and longer service intervals.

Such flexibility empowers foundries to adopt a cost-effective approach by balancing wheel investment against operational demands.
